The State of Full Service Restaurants

Modern Restaurant Management

Seventy-four percent of full service restaurants (FSRs) managed to maintain or increase their sales during the pandemic; however, profit margins in 2021 declined to 10 percent, compared to 12 percent in 2019, according to third annual State of Full Service Restaurants Report released by TouchBistro.
